What is new jersey government records

The New Jersey Government Records Request Form is a legal document used by individuals to access government records under the New Jersey Open Public Records Act (OPRA).

What is the New Jersey Government Records Request Form?

The New Jersey Government Records Request Form is a crucial tool designed for individuals looking to access public records as per the New Jersey Open Public Records Act (OPRA). This form is essential for ensuring transparency within governmental operations, allowing citizens to request various records held by public agencies.
Anyone, including residents, researchers, and organizations, can utilize this form to request information ranging from financial disclosures to meeting minutes. The New Jersey Government Records Request Form facilitates the pursuit of knowledge, empowering citizens with the information they need.

Fees, Deadlines, and Processing Time for the New Jersey Government Records Request Form

It's important to be aware of the fees associated with processing the New Jersey Government Records Request Form. There can be charges for copies of records, though fee waivers may be available under certain circumstances.
Requests should be submitted ahead of deadlines specified by the relevant government agencies, allowing for typical processing times to be managed effectively. Understanding these timelines ensures that requestors remain informed during the review process.

What Happens After You Submit the New Jersey Government Records Request Form?

Once the form is submitted, the review process begins. Requestors will receive a notification regarding the status of their submission, whether approved, denied, or requiring additional information.
If a request is denied or amendments are necessary, clear instructions will be provided on how to proceed. This transparency is a key aspect of the New Jersey Open Public Records Act.

Anyone can submit a request using the New Jersey Government Records Request Form, as it is designed for residents and non-residents seeking access to government records under the OPRA.
Typically, no supporting documents are required to submit the New Jersey Government Records Request Form. However, providing personal identification or relevant details may help in processing your request.
After filling out the form, you can submit it directly through pdfFiller by using the available submission options, such as email, or download the form and mail it to the appropriate government agency.
Processing times for records requests can vary, but typically, agencies are required to respond within seven business days. Be sure to check with the specific agency if you need more detailed information.
If you realize you've made a mistake, it’s important to correct it before submission. Many forms allow you to edit entries easily on pdfFiller, so take the time to review thoroughly.
Fees may be applicable for obtaining copies of records or for certain processing charges. Check with the specific agency for their fee schedule regarding government records requests.
No, you should submit separate forms for each different records request you wish to make, as each form is tailored to a specific set of records under OPRA.
